  • Jan 17, 1997
    William Lee Golden joins the Alabama Music Hall of Fame during an event at the Von Braun Civic Center in Huntsville. Added the same night: Rose Maddox, Lionel Richie, producer Kelso Herston, steel guitarist Don Davis and The Speer Family
    Dec 4, 2018
    Record executive, producer and guitarist Kelso Herston dies in Nashville. A former Nashville chief for United Artists and Capitol, he produced hits for Sonny James, Ferlin Husky and Del Reeves, and added guitar to singles by George Jones, Leroy Van Dyke and Billy "Crash" Craddock
